Public Notice: ASHLAND CITY COUNCIL & ASHLAND PARK AND RECREATION COMMISSION

May 4, 2024

SPECIAL MEETING AGENDA
WEDNESDAY, MAY 8, 2024
Council Chambers, 1175 E Main Street

5 -7:30 p.m. Special Meeting

  1. Oregon Government Ethics Commission
    1. Ethics Law Training

*No decisions will be made

**No public forum

*** This meeting will note be televised
